Cheonan Gears Up for Children's Happiness Week: A Festive Celebration for Youngsters

HONG MOON HWA Senior Reporter / Updated : 2025-04-05 14:08:12
  • -
  • +
  • Print

Cheonan, South Korea - Cheonan City is thrilled to announce its upcoming "Cheonan Children's Happiness Week," scheduled to take place from May 1st to 6th in celebration of the 103rd National Children's Day. Under the vibrant theme "Gather! Play! Dream! LaLaLa Cheonan Children's Festival," the week-long event promises a diverse array of engaging programs designed for children and their families to enjoy and connect throughout Cheonan.

The festivities will be structured around four exciting themes: Festa Day, Culture Day, Arts Day, and Sports Day, ensuring a wide range of activities to cater to various interests.

The highlight of the week, Festa Day, will be held on Children's Day itself, May 5th, at Cheonan City Sports Park. This celebratory day will feature an official Children's Day ceremony alongside a "LaLaLa Playground," captivating children's performances, and interactive experience booths brimming with fun and excitement for the young attendees.

Culture Day, spanning from May 1st to 4th across various locations in Cheonan, will offer enriching cultural experiences. Families can look forward to family movie screenings, an art competition showcasing young talent, and a delightful "LaLaLa Pizza Making" session where children can get hands-on in creating their own delicious pizzas.

Art Day will take center stage from May 4th to 6th at the Cheonan Children's Dream Center. This segment will proudly display the winning entries from the art competition, as well as a charming exhibition of children's photography, offering a glimpse into the creative world of Cheonan's youth.

Concluding the week's celebrations is Sports Day on May 6th. The Cheonan Sports Complex auxiliary stadium will transform into a hub of energetic activity as it hosts the "LaLaLa Football Festival" in collaboration with Cheonan City FC. This event promises a fun-filled day of football-related games and activities for children.

Enthusiastic families looking to participate in the family movie screenings, the "LaLaLa Pizza Making," and the "LaLaLa Football Festival" can register on a first-come, first-served basis from April 7th to 20th. To ensure broad participation, duplicate applications for these specific events will be limited.

In addition to these main events, the Cheonan Children's Happiness Week will also feature supplementary events such as the aforementioned art competition and a dynamic "Dancing Kids Competition," adding even more opportunities for children to showcase their talents and have fun. Detailed schedules and further information about all the events can be found on the official Cheonan Children's Day website.

Cheonan Mayor Park Sang-don expressed his hopes for the event, stating, "Through this week-long celebration, I hope that children can laugh to their hearts' content and feel happiness while spending quality time with their families. Above all, we will prioritize the safety of our children and meticulously prepare to ensure that all families can participate with peace of mind."

This comprehensive week of activities underscores Cheonan City's commitment to fostering a joyful and enriching environment for its youngest citizens and their families.
